Case Summary: SLP(Crl) No. 1499/2004 - Bijendra Singh v. State of U.P. Bijendra Singh filed a Special Leave Petition challenging the High Court of Allahabad's judgment dated December 2, 2003 in Criminal Appeal No. 822/81. The petition also included applications for bail and exemption from filing the Original Transcript. On April 30, 2004, the Supreme Court bench comprising Justice N. Santosh Hegde and Justice B.P. Singh heard the matter. The Court dismissed the Special Leave Petition with no further relief granted. This case analysis is maintained by casestatus.in based on publicly available court records.
